Transaction 3d027f491b30fdd5215b43ea511da340b9fc181563885c767754728ba6cd7f16

1 Input
2 Outputs
  • 3d027f491b30fdd5215b43ea511da340b9fc181563885c767754728ba6cd7f16:0
  • value  630173
    address  3JhG5QkR78kUUSrwuRzH6ykB21gApkVph7
  • 3d027f491b30fdd5215b43ea511da340b9fc181563885c767754728ba6cd7f16:1
  • value  12588454
    address  1BtwYcCUkLRUkuYa7HSr1iXzDithik9iv